November is National Family Caregivers Month. The 16th annual Washington County Family Caregiver Conference will take place on Friday, November 15, from 8:30 a.m.-3 p.m., at Tuality Health Education Center, 334 SE 8th Ave, Hillsboro. This free conference is for unpaid family caregivers of older adults. Lunch is included. Space is limited, and registration is required.

This year’s conference, Connecting through Caregiving: Honoring Every Family Caregiver’s Voice, features keynote speaker Elizabeth Eckstrom, MD, MPH, who will present “You CAN Do This: Practical Tools to Build Caregiver Resilience.” Dr. Eckstrom is a professor and chief of geriatrics at OHSU. Her research focuses on promoting a healthy lifestyle in older adults.

Breakout sessions include legal considerations for family caregivers, navigating the aging system, creative engagement, finding ease in caregiving and more.

Simultaneous interpretation will be offered in Spanish to those who request it when registering. Participants who require other accommodations should make their request at least seven days in advance.
